Effects of Sensory Motor Training on Balance and Proprioception Among Post-Menopausal Obese Women

Postmenopausal obese women often have difficulties with balance and proprioception. Sensorimotor training is an important part of physical therapy interventions, with emerging evidence that it could be beneficial for postmenopausal obese women.

Objective: To find the impact of sensorimotor training on balance and proprioception among postmenopausal obese women.

About this study

Randomized clinical trial was conducted on postmenopausal obese women population with impaired balance and proprioception on inclusion & exclusion criteria, sample size of 40, ages ranged from 45 to 65 years included. Group A received SMT and Group B received CT. The interval of treatment was 6 weeks. Data is collected from THQ Samundri. FRT, TUG, OLS utilized to assess the pre-and post-estimations of postural strength.

Treatment and study plan

Sensorimotor Training Exercises

Other

Sensorimotor training exercises include wall slides , core exercises (Planks, leg raises, crunches, bridging) balance exercises (single leg side lift, leg lift with dumble, balance on stability ball) on unstable surface for 50-60 min (3 sets of 10 rep) of exercises and gait training (different patterns of walking

Without Sensorimotor training exercises

Other

Cut back on high-fat foods. Drink plenty of water Use sugar and salt in moderation. Eat fruits and vegetables Get enough calcium Pump up your iron. Get enough fiber

Primary outcomes

  1. Functional Reach Test (FRT)

    Time frame: 2 months

    Functional Reach Test (FRT) is a clinical outcome measure used to asses dynamic balance in one simple task.

  2. Time Up and Go Test (TUG)

    Time frame: 2 months

    Time Up and Go test is used to assess the individual's mobility, static and dynamic balance walking ability and risk of fall among older adults. Intratester and intertester reliability (ICC) in elderly populations

  3. One Leg Stance Test (OLS)

    Time frame: 2 months

    The Single leg Stance (SLS) Test is used to evaluate static postural and balance control with one eye open and standing on one leg
